About This Iced Tea Series:

Here are FIVE unique iced tea blends we’ve created from high quality Nilgiri CTC teas. These are uber fine teas, so they are not as pretty as our whole leaf teas, but they steep up a bold, rich, flavorful iced tea. We’ve packaged them in one ounce pouches, which is just enough for one gallon of iced tea (more if you re-steep) so you can just rip them open, dump them out and steep. No measuring required!

Taster’s Review:

I don’t know if I’m just getting better at brewing iced tea (it does take me a couple of times to really get into the swing of it), or what, but, it seems like these blends from 52Teas keep getting tastier.  This one is amazingly good.

The flavor is INTENSE!  I am not one to judge alcoholic drinks since I don’t drink them often (read:  almost never), but, based on my memory of the few piña coladas I’ve had in my life, this tastes remarkably like them.  Basically, if you were to take a piña colada and mix it with some Nilgiri black tea – that’s what this tastes like.

The black tea is much less pronounced here than it is in the previous tastings in this iced tea series.  That is not to say it’s too weak, because I can taste the Nilgiri black tea here, but, the piña colada flavor is the dominating taste.

The pineapple and coconut are quite harmonious, and there is just a hint of rum.  This is just the way I would want a piña colada to taste if I were to order it in a bar.  But then, why pay $9 bucks for a fancy, bar-made piña colada when I can have this at home for a fraction of that?  That’s an awful lot to pay for the paper umbrella and a hangover.
